Output 58545bea335e1192bfffa15d77ac02020cf5f7707689579efd3d38581fea0009:0

value
25382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 462cbdf4a34092adc858c7a5d2401858cc201f23 OP_EQUAL
address
3864pheBTuPuJhSbE4oqnkyL1fR6gUW72V
transaction
58545bea335e1192bfffa15d77ac02020cf5f7707689579efd3d38581fea0009
spent
true